Examples
The following example configures several remote subscribers.
se-10-0-0-0# config t
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user2 location sjc create
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user2 phonenumber 84444
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user5 location sjc create
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user5 phonenumber 81111
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user3 location nyc create
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user3 phonenumber 92222
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user4 location nyc create
se-10-0-0-0(config)# remote username user4 phonenumber 93333
se-10-0-0-0(config)# end
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user2 fullname display “User 2”
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user2 fullname first User
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user2 fullname last 2
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user5 fullname display “User 5”
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user5 fullname first User
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user5 fullname last 5
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user3 fullname display “User” 3
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user3 fullname first User
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user3 fullname last 3
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user4 fullname display “User 4”
Command or Action Purpose
Step 1
remote username username location location-id create
Example:
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user1 location sjc create
Adds the subscriber with username at the location 
location-id to the local directory.
An error message appears if one of the following 
conditions occurs:
  • A local subscriber, group, or remote 
subscriber exists with this username.
  • The maximum number of remote subscribers 
is already configured on the system.
  • location-id does not exist.
  • location-id is the local location.
Step 2
remote username username fullname display display-name
Example:
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user1 fullname display 
“Al Brown”
Associates the remote subscriber username with a 
display name.
Step 3
remote username username fullname first first-name
Example:
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user1 fullname first Al
Associates the remote subscriber username with a 
first name for display.
Step 4
remote username username fullname last last-name
Example:
se-10-0-0-0# remote username user1 fullname last Brown
Associates the remote subscriber username with a 
last name for display.
